[fpc-devel] Language extension: absolute for classes
    Micha Nelissen 
    micha at neli.hopto.org
       
    Sun Oct  1 22:19:58 CEST 2006
    
    
  
Marco van de Voort wrote:
>> Changing type to something which is not a descendant (and thus
>> incompatible) seems useless and always dangerous to me, so should be
>> forbidden if possible.
> 
> I also considered it that way. But maybe the "absolute" keyword is then a
> bit badly chosen, since it implies memory overlaying, no questions asked.
Yes, agree, but the way of use is so similar. Maybe the other usages
should get this checking as well ;-).
Maybe 'override' instead, but that one is so closely tied to functions,
and implies something 'virtual' as well.
Micha
    
    
More information about the fpc-devel
mailing list